Understanding Pinion Gear Specifications
Pinion gears come in various specifications that determine their performance and compatibility with different systems. Key specifications include the pitch, diameter, and the number of teeth. The pitch refers to the distance between the teeth and is crucial for ensuring that the pinion gear meshes correctly with other gears in the system. A mismatch in pitch can lead to inefficient operation or even damage to both the pinion and its mating gear.
The diameter of the pinion gear affects its torque and speed characteristics. Generally, a larger diameter can transmit more torque, making it suitable for heavy-duty applications. However, this also means the gear may be slower in operation. Conversely, smaller diameter pinion gears tend to achieve higher speeds but transmit less torque, which is essential to consider based on the application requirements.
Additionally, the material used to manufacture the pinion gear influences its durability and operational lifespan. Common materials include steel, aluminum, and various composites. While steel gears are robust and ideal for applications that require strength, aluminum gears are lighter and usually employed in applications where weight savings are essential. Understanding these specifications will help buyers make informed choices that align with their project’s needs and performance expectations.

Maintenance Tips for Pinion Gears
Regular maintenance of pinion gears is essential for ensuring their longevity and efficient operation. One of the most important practices is lubrication. Proper lubrication reduces friction between the gear teeth, minimizing wear and tear. It is advisable to use high-quality grease or oil formulated specifically for the gear material and its application environment. Checking and replenishing lubrication at regular intervals is critical, especially in high-load or high-speed applications.
Another vital maintenance tip is to inspect the pinion gear for any signs of damage or wear. Common indications of wear include missing or chipped teeth, uneven surfaces, and discoloration from heat. Regular visual checks can help identify these problems early, allowing for timely repairs or replacements before they lead to significant operational failures.
Alignment is also crucial for the longevity of pinion gears. Misalignment can lead to premature wear, noise, and increased risk of failure. It is essential to ensure that the pinion gear is correctly aligned with its mating gears, particularly during installation. This involves checking the spacing and positioning of the gears, making adjustments if needed. By following these maintenance tips, users can enhance the performance and lifespan of their pinion gears, ultimately leading to more efficient operation in their applications.

4. What materials are commonly used for pinion gears, and how do they affect performance?
Pinion gears are often constructed from materials such as steel, aluminum, and plastic, each offering unique benefits and drawbacks. Steel gears are known for their strength and durability, making them ideal for heavy-duty applications where high torque is required. They are resistant to wear and can withstand significant mechanical stress, ensuring longevity and consistent performance in demanding environments.
On the other hand, aluminum is lighter than steel and provides an excellent strength-to-weight ratio, making it a popular choice for applications that prioritize weight savings, such as in racing or lightweight machinery. Plastic gears, while less durable, are frequently used in lower-stress situations due to their lightweight characteristics and noise-absorbing qualities. When selecting a material, consider the specific demands of your application, including load requirements and environmental factors.
5. Can I use a pinion gear from one brand with a gear from another brand?
Yes, you can often use pinion gears from one brand with gears from another brand, but compatibility is key. The most crucial factors to ensure compatibility include the gear’s pitch, tooth count, and dimensions. If both gears share the same specifications, they should mesh correctly, allowing for effective power transmission. However, variations in the manufacturing processes and tolerances of different brands may occasionally lead to performance issues, so it’s wise to double-check specifications.
Additionally, consider whether the materials and construction techniques used in each pinion gear will work well together. For example, pairing a high-strength steel pinion with a plastic gear may lead to premature wear or failure in the plastic part. Whenever possible, select gears designed for use together or at the very least, check for user reviews that validate cross-brand compatibility.
